Every guy should have several go-to date spots to take women to. These places should be comfortable and reliable. Depending on where you live, you may have a larger or smaller selection, but always having a few in your back pocket will come in handy when planning a night out or in a spontaneous situation. As a resident of New York City, I feel that I need to have a few go-to spots in almost every neighborhood of Manhattan. This ends up being a pretty long list due to the size of the island, but it’s well worth knowing what’s close by at a minute’s notice.

I know we don’t like to admit it, but men have many things to worry about when taking out women. Besides the general things like presenting yourself well or having topics to discuss, we have to think about where to go, what to do, what will she like, will we have to wait, where can we go if the wait is too long, where should we go afterwards, etc. The less a guy has to worry about these things, the more he can focus on himself and the conversation between him and his date.
